Narrative:On September 22, 1973, during the Soviet-Hungarian exercise Vertes-73, a formation of three MiG-21s of the 515 IAP crashed into the ground in adverse weather conditions near Veszprém.
Squadron Commander, Major Albert Mikhailovich Alferov was killed.
